Bottom line is -  I came up with the hitch idea, built one on our old camper trailer so we could tow it behind Lindi, the Chamberlain 6G. We found that it towed incredibly well behind conventional vehicles, so built another for our new camper trailer and got the design certified. After putting a couple on friend?s trailers, they said I should be marketing them. Giving it a try now

Jarrod , you are right it?s not that we are being shut down -it?s compliance that we feel we can?t achieve and still break even on costs .

If we had unlimited resources and money it would be cracking on full noise, We are allowed to hold an event with an approved plan in place. But You may not like what restrictions are needed to hold the event and fully comply- We didn?t Need the extra work nor a fine for someone else?s ignorance to the current rules. The last thing we wanted to do all weekend was to run around separating people and enforcing rules that are beyond our control.

The rules/guidelines are a little more achievable for events under 500 people but we are WELL over that amount of people on site.
